Dear plugin authors, the batched-resolver cut-over for the Queryloom gateway finished this morning. Nested field resolution now goes through the dataloader layer, so the N+1 pattern that inflated response times on deep selections is gone. Most plugins need no changes, but any plugin issuing direct per-row fetches inside a resolver should migrate to the batch hook before the compatibility shim is removed next quarter. For reference, the gateway is now running with the configuration values below.

service settings:
[casax]
port = 6379
team = rusir
host = casax.zemvarhq.corp
region = outer-4
access_code = ac_9808ce
timeout_ms = 1500

# Retirement of the Corvane 300 Line (Managers Only)

This page documents the phased retirement of the Corvane 300 product line. Production ends next quarter; service parts remain available for eighteen months. Branch managers should redirect customers to the Corvane 500 series and avoid committing to legacy orders. Please review the confidential planning note that follows.

internal memo for kawip-hadug: Headcount on the Wenwyn team goes from 7 to 140 by the end of January. Gross margin on Wenwyn came in at 20 percent against a plan of 15 percent.

# Provenance: Cold Storage Archival

When the Norlund archiver moves a bucket to cold tier, it emits a signed provenance record capturing the source manifest, archival policy version, and executing build. On-call engineers restoring data should always verify this record first. Each archival run is identified by the trace token below.

trace token, kawip-fafog: htk14_26e64c4d35154e

The Pellamay reminder job posts to the internal Notifly API at /v2/reminders, batching up to 200 appointments per call. Requests must include tenant ID, appointment window, and template slug; Notifly validates against the clinic calendar before enqueueing. Failures return 422 with per-record errors; the job retries soft failures twice. Authentication uses a static service key passed in the Authorization header. For reviewing the staging configuration, the current staging key is included below.

API key for yahig-tadup: kto7_ubizbYm